My Students
Spanish, Afrikaans, Arabic, Fulani, Swahili, Chinese, English, Creole, and American Sign Language are just a few of the languages our students exposed to on a daily basis--both in the home and at school. My students, whom are Deaf and Hard of Hearing, are in a self-contained total communication program located in the Bronx, NY. We simultaneously use various forms of communication in our room to fit the needs of each learner. My students are very hard working compassionate kids with a love of learning and experiencing new things first hand. They are all incredibly intelligent and intuitive, but lack of language exposure and often times lack of resources contribute to their lack of understanding and access to grade appropriate instruction. For this very reason, literacy instruction is key to their success and eventual language acquisition.
It is our goal to facilitate their learning through hands-on student-centered experiences, while challenging preconditioned notions of society, their home communities and themselves.
The expectation is that they will become critical thinkers that will formulate their own opinions about the world and change it for the better.
My Project
With today's ever-changing landscape of education and the workforce, it is very clear that children need experience and knowledge in coding and technology to be career and college ready. Research notes that the earlier exposure to STEAM activities benefits the overall learning experience and outcomes for children. This is an advantage I would like to provide for my students. Deaf and Hard of Hearing students are generally visual and first-hand learners. These coding kits will allow our Deaf and Hard of Hearing students to independently gain exposure to these fields and transfer skills to other disciplines. During these activities, professionals working with our deaf and hard of hearing students can work on communication needs in spoken and signed languages.
